Abstract

The invention discloses a bridge steel cable protection system with fireproof, damp-proof and anti-theft functions. The bridge steel cable protection system comprises an inhaul cable and a protection fireproof layer on the outer side of the inhaul cable. Multiple hoops are evenly fastened to the outer side of the protection fireproof layer at intervals in the length direction of the inhaul cable. The hoops are provided with a plurality of axially through blow-by holes; clamping grooves are formed in the two outer side walls of the hoops in the radial direction and communicate with the blow-by holes; an outer protective sleeve comprises two semi-cylindrical pipes; the butt joint faces of the two semi-cylindrical pipes are axially provided with inserting grooves, and the two semi-cylindrical pipes are fixed in a butt joint mode through the corresponding inserting grooves through connecting clamping plates. The side walls of the semi-cylindrical pipes are provided with axially-through air inlet channels. An insertion opening is formed in the bottom end of each air inlet channel, and an insertion head which protrudes out of the top edge of each semi-cylindrical pipe and can be matched with the insertion opening is arranged at the top end of the air inlet channel; clamping pipes clamped with the clamping grooves are arranged on the inner side walls of the semi-cylindrical pipes, and the clamping pipes are communicated with the air inlet channels and the blow-by holes; and the top edges and the bottom edges of the semi-cylindrical pipes are provided with buckle structures which can be correspondingly clamped and fixed.

Description

technical field [0001] The invention relates to the technical fields of fireproofing, moistureproofing and theftproofing of cables of cable-stayed bridges, and more specifically relates to a bridge steel cable protection system with functions of fireproofing, moistureproofing and theftproofing. Background technique [0002] In order to improve the fireproof performance of cable-stayed bridge steel cables, in the prior art, the surface of the steel cables is first wrapped with a fireproof layer, and basalt fiber strips with a thickness of 3-5 mm are used to spirally wind the surface of the steel cables, and then the winding The outer layer of the formed fireproof layer is bonded to the sealing layer, and the sealing layer is directly wrapped on site by the basalt mesh cloth through the processing technology of four glues and three cloths.
